Key Insights

  • Tareck El Aissami, former Venezuelan Minister of Petroleum, claims he is close to death due to health complications.
  • He is accused of embezzling between $16 billion and $21 billion from oil exports.
  • He requested a public trial and alleged torture and isolation.
